Nordstrom Rack’s Adornia crystal ring set drops to $29.97
A three-band Adornia stack in stainless steel, gold plate and rhodium plate is marked down to $29.97, with shoppers praising its no-discoloration wear.

Nordstrom Rack has put a clean, easy-to-wear crystal stack within reach: the Adornia Water Resistant Swarovski Crystal Studded Band - Set of 3 is listed at $29.97, down from $175, with 343 customer reviews and a 3.9-out-of-5 rating. The draw is not excess. Each band is slim at 3mm, finished in 14K yellow-gold plate, rose-gold plate and white rhodium plate over stainless steel, then set with bezel-mounted Swarovski crystals for a restrained bit of sparkle that reads more polished than party.
That balance matters. The three rings can be worn together as a single stack or split across fingers, which makes the set useful for readers who like the layered-ring look but do not want the clutter that often comes with trend-heavy styling. The mixed finishes give enough variation to feel styled without veering into costume jewelry, and the bezel settings keep the crystals tucked into the band rather than sitting high and snag-prone. Nordstrom Rack says the set is made in the USA and returnable within 40 days, two practical details that make the price easier to assess as an everyday purchase rather than a fleeting impulse buy.
